Transaction 99a58b42b987a756f2e5106703c9124f973465d41beb717ad5995bd747b84ff4

1 Input
2 Outputs
  • 99a58b42b987a756f2e5106703c9124f973465d41beb717ad5995bd747b84ff4:0
  • value  516594
    address  39kt3KJQzSv72D9Ei8kbFjdPc95sFH64Wp
  • 99a58b42b987a756f2e5106703c9124f973465d41beb717ad5995bd747b84ff4:1
  • value  4583521
    address  bc1qujehk893hdlshskw4gtsllqj8hs200ll0k8438